Did Jessica Simpson try to start a food fight with Tony Romo's ex Carrie Underwood?

The singer, 27, wore a "Real Girls Eat Meat" T-shirt (which she got for free from steakhouse Primehouse New York) during a weekend outing with Romo, who dated Underwood in 2007.

Underwood was named PETA's Sexiest Vegetarian in 2005.

PETA quickly jumped to Underwood's defense.

"Jessica Simpson's meaty wardrobe malfunction makes us thankful that no one is looking to her for food advice. Chicken-of-the-Sea, anyone?" a PETA rep tells Usmagazine.com. "The woman who thought that Buffalo 'Wings' came from buffalos would benefit from some good veggie brain food."

Adds the rep: "We're rushing Jessica one of our Vegetarian Starter Kits."
